Orlando Pride Announce 2018 Preseason Schedule

The Orlando Pride will play preseason friendlies against Florida State, Central Florida, and South Florida in the lead-up to the 2018 NWSL season — the club’s third since joining the league. Players will report for team medicals on Sunday, Feb. 18, with the first day of training on Feb. 19.

The friendlies will take place on Wednesday, Feb. 28, Saturday, March 3, and Thursday, March 8 at Seminole Soccer Complex in Tallahassee (as opposed to the one in Seminole County), UCF Soccer and Track Complex, and Corbett Stadium, respectively. The Pride visit Tallahassee on Feb. 28 at 6 p.m. in the first of the three preseason matches. It is open to the public and admission is free. The match at UCF on March 3 is closed to the public, and the final preseason friendly takes place at USF on March 8. Tickets for that match can be purchased here. The general admission tickets are $9 each.

Tom Sermanni’s side has played Florida State before each of its NWSL seasons but this will be the first time Orlando has taken on UCF.

The Pride are coming off their first NWSL playoff appearance and will be looking to contend for an NWSL title in 2018.

Key Orlando Pride Preseason Dates

Sun., Feb. 18 — Preseason Medical Evaluations at Orlando Health

Mon., Feb. 19 — Preseason Begins

Wed., Feb. 28 — Preseason Game at Florida State University at Seminole Soccer Complex, 6 p.m.

Sat., March 3 — Preseason Game at University of Central Florida at UCF Soccer and Track Complex (Closed match)

Thurs., March 8 — Preseason Game at University of South Florida at Corbett Soccer Stadium, 7 p.m.
